Smithsonite Pseudomorph after, Calcite, with Quartz, San Antonio Mine, Santa Eulalia, Chihuahua, Mexico

$800.00

Size: 11.2×8.3×7.4 cm

Species: Smithsonite Pseudomorph after, Calcite, with Quartz

Locality: San Antonio Mine, Santa Eulalia, Chihuahua, Mexico

Description: This is a neat specimen with pseudomorphs of smithsonite after scalenohedral calcite crystals. What is unique about this specimen is the quartz on the front with an inclusion that is of a blue grey color. This association at the mine was very unusual. Ex. Terry Huizing, Peter Megaw
